My five favourite mums

It’s Day 4 of the Write Tribe’s super initiative ‘7 days of rediscovering your blogging grove’ Where we blog seven days in a row according to a format. The idea is inspired by Darren Rowse. We’ve done a list , answered a question, written a review  and today, we share our favourite links.

And so here I am, listing links from five wonderful mothers who I enjoy reading. This in no way is a comprehensive list.

http://www.mommy-labs.com/
The blog chronicles the homeschooling journey of 8 year old Pari by her mother Rashmie. It is a wonderful mix of learning and fun, art and activities, music and photography. And it’s a storehouse of ideas on teaching kids, talking to them and reaching out to them.

http://themadmomma.wordpress.com/
I have blogged about the mad momma earlier. A more straight-from-the-heart, no nonsense blog you’ll not find. This isn’t strictly a mommy blog because the mad momma writes pretty much about anything that catches her fancy. But it’s all immensely relatable.

Quirkymomma.com/kidsactivitiesblog.com
This one’s my ‘go to’ place for crafts, activities, recipes, DIYs. It’s crammed with creative fun ideas on every topic under the sun.

http://www.scarymommy.com/
This one kicked off as a baby-book by stay-at-home mom Jill Smokler. I love it for it’s irreverent take on parenting. It’s funny and witty and useful. I love the listicles posted here. There is even a confessional where you can spill all your bad-momma feelings.

http://momofrs.wordpress.com/
Momofrs’ blog Mothering Multiples was one of the first few blogs I started reading after I got back to the real world post the twins’ arrival in my life. Here’s another lady who writes from the heart and is unflinchingly honest – too unflinchingly honest sometimes. She has twins, like me; a boy and a girl – like me and it’s super fun to read her stories which seem sometimes like an uncanny retelling of my own.
